Intervale Compost Could Wind Up in Williston
Despite an agreement to begin shutting down the composting operation in Burlington's Intervale next month, truckloads of organic wastes could still be arriving at the site nearly a year from now under a proposal by the project's owner, the Chittenden Solid Waste District.
